Kiln Family Trust
Details
The Kiln family trust can support nationwide charities and UK charities working abroad. However, emphasis will be given to local charities [Hertfordshire, England] and projects in the local area of trustees, where a modest grant will make a real difference.
They will consider applications to fund charity operating costs.
The Trust’s grant-making focuses on the following areas of interest to trustees:
- Amateur sport
 - Environment, wildlife & conservation
 - Advancement of health
 - Gender equity & empowerment
